Output 8fa04d357817b9121efa244a0095f358d5de5b12058ac5c980e9a15b1960428f:1

value
88542637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a84044ee51ac53cbc0694cc03aa94562563d51ab OP_EQUAL
address
3H2eSH4tpZCJpuRqG7YdLybPCkwzwDyNWs
transaction
8fa04d357817b9121efa244a0095f358d5de5b12058ac5c980e9a15b1960428f
spent
true